  • FIFA Corruption

    The FIFA scandals reveal a disturbing pattern of bribery and fraud that has enabled sportswashing on a global scale. explains how Qatar, despite having no significant soccer history, won the bid to host the 2022 World Cup over more established nations due to corrupt practices within FIFA 1. A decade-long investigation by the US Department of Justice confirmed that representatives from Qatar and Russia bribed FIFA officials to secure their bids 2.

    FIFA, the organization in charge of soccer worldwide, is known to be one of the most openly corrupt and unchallengeable mafias in history.

    This corruption has not only tarnished the reputation of the sport but also allowed authoritarian regimes to use soccer as a tool for image laundering.

    Premier League Scandal

    The Premier League is not immune to corruption, with financial irregularities and questionable investors influencing the sport. discusses the allegations against Manchester City, which has been accused of inflating earnings through dubious sponsorship deals to circumvent financial fair play rules 3. This scandal highlights the broader issue of sportswashing, where regimes use sports to improve their image despite ongoing human rights abuses 4.

    Manchester City might be expelled from the league altogether, or perhaps relegated, and they might lose all of their trophies over the last ten years.

    The involvement of wealthy investors from countries with poor human rights records further complicates efforts to maintain integrity in the sport.
